@@ -62,3 +62,26 @@ * has a custom versions of `openFd` which allows more control over the flags than its unix package counterpart * adds a `getDirectoryContents'` version that works on Fd +## Examples in ghci++Start ghci via `cabal repl`:++```hs+-- enable OverloadedStrings+:set -XOverloadedStrings+-- import HPath.IO+import HPath.IO+-- parse an absolute path+abspath <- parseAbs "/home"+-- parse a relative path (e.g. user users home directory)+relpath <- parseRel "jule"+-- concatenate paths+let newpath = abspath </> relpath+-- get file type+getFileType newpath+-- return all contents of that directory+getDirsFiles newpath+-- return all contents of the parent directory+getDirsFiles (dirname newpath)+```+
